Easy to manage tasks and set rules for automation, plus satisfying animations
What do you like best about the product?
Asana makes it easy for me to view and reorder my tasks. Whether I'm viewing in a list or board view, I can reorder tasks by dragging, which isn't a given in other project management software. When I click on a task, its detail view appears on the side of my screen instead of covering the entire screen or opening a new page, so it's easy for me to click through each of my tasks in a list. The My Tasks view is useful for organizing tasks across multiple projects by due date so I don't get overwhelmed. I can see which ones I have to work on today vs. later - allowing me to plan my week - and tasks automatically move up to the Today section once their due date approaches. Adding tasks and subtasks in list view is also quick. All you have to do is type and hit Enter instead of clicking multiple buttons.
What do you dislike about the product?
Currently, I'm the only one using it on my team. But in a previous role, I used it with many others, and I remember that the comments section in each task was hard to read when too many images were pasted. It might be nice if images could have their own captions or images were made smaller and flowed horizontally if there were a lot in one comment.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
Every other task or project management software that I've tried makes it hard to quickly view a list of, reorder, or add tasks. I haven't had those issues with Asana at all, so I can focus on design instead of organizing my to-dos. It keeps me from getting overwhelmed because it organizes and automatically moves my tasks based on due date.

Making Project Management & Collaboration Easier
What do you like best about the product?
Asana helps me manage individual tasks and collaborative projects. I like having the ability to track progress, assign tasks to others, and see how projects or tasks fit within larger team and individual goals. It's nice receiving an email every morning with a summary of the tasks due that day.
What do you dislike about the product?
When you create a task to assign to someone, it sends the task/assigns it to them before the details are fully added. This has caused confusion. I wish that it would wait to send it until certain details, like the due date, were included.
Tasks that are due at a specific time in the day should appear at the top of the list instead of at the bottom of the list of tasks due that day.
Subtasks aren't always clear. The user must click for additional details to see what the original task was and dig through to find relevant information.

What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
I used to use the tasks feature within Outlook to keep track of anything that I needed to do and when it was due. That wasn't as collaborative, and I couldn't (or didn't know how) to organize tasks by projects. Asana makes it much easier to work with others and understand how my work contributes to my team and organizational goals.
